Marcus J. Ranum wrote:

> Bear in mind that logs may be quite "bursty" depending on what
> is happening and if something happens that affects a large number
> of machines, the "burstiness" can cause the dam to burst, too. :)

I know you may not wish to go that route, but this is a rather simple
queueing network problem, so if you know the infrastructure of your
logging system you may model it mathematically and know exactly how the
"burstiness" may affect it.

A helper application: http://jmt.sourceforge.net/
